CVE-2025-68729

Kernel crash via unfreed RX error buffers

Published Dec 24, 2025 · Updated Dec 24, 2025

Resource leak in Linux kernel 6.3 through 6.17.12 and 6.18.0 through 6.18.1 allows attackers to crash systems via Wi-Fi packets. ath12k_hal_desc_reo_parse_err() rejects MSDU buffers where it expects link descriptors, but the RX error path returns without freeing the associated skb. A system must use the ath12k driver with compatible Qualcomm hardware; repeated receipt leaks kernel memory until resource exhaustion crashes the host.
